What is Mental Illness?
Mental illness is disease, dysfunction, or disruption of the brain, leading to negative thoughts and behaviors. Ranging from substance use disorders to generalized anxiety, there are several types of mental health conditions.

Types of Mental Health Providers in East Islip, NY
No two people with mental illness experience it in the exact same way. As such, there are various types of mental health professionals that use different techniques and serve distinct roles.
Psychologists in East Islip
A psychologist is a mental health professional who is trained to conduct psychological evaluations and make diagnoses. They’re skilled in helping individuals understand and cope with their feelings and thoughts, and usually do so through talk therapy in an individual or group setting. The majority of treatment zeros in on addressing and resolving destructive and otherwise unhealthy behaviors.
Psychiatrists in East Islip
Sometimes there is a need for more immediate or intense treatment compared to what a psychologist can offer - namely prescription medication. Psychiatrists are physicians (medical doctors) who specialize in mental illness and therefore can offer prescription medication. Although they are trained and qualified to conduct psychotherapy (talk therapy), not all psychiatrists do.
Therapists, Counselors & Clinicians in East Islip
All are interchangeable terms used to describe mental health care professionals with a masters-level education in fields such as psychology, marriage and family therapy, or other specialties. They work more like psychologists than psychiatrists, being treatment-focused often with an emphasis on modifying behavior. More often than not, individual and group therapy is the primary treatment approach.
Paying for East Islip Mental Health Services
When considering paying for mental health rehab, most individuals will have a few different options depending on financial circumstances. As mentioned previously, reaching out to your insurance provider is wise. They will likely even be able to provide recommendations for in-network mental health rehabs. Option 2 is out-of-pocket payment. This is a common route for people who choose a mental health rehab not covered by their insurance, or when they do not have health insurance. The final option would be to select a state-funded program if you are uninsured or lack the financial means to pay privately.
